Failed when try to discover a Canon ImageCLASS MF4420n scanner with error message: "skipping, none of supported protocols discovered".
sane-airscan version: 0.99.29-1

On the printer(with scanner ability), the "WSD Print Setting" has been setup as following lines:
Use WSD Printing: On
Use WSD Browsing: On
Use Multicast Discovery: On
On the machine running airscan, I captured the UDP protocol packets during discovery, and find out that the scanner does return contents with xml stuff, but the machine running airscan only returns a ICMP message with Destination unreachable(Port unreachable).
